Today (29 August), the Victoria government announced it has streamlined the planning process to deliver the state's “largest” battery energy storage system (BESS), ACEnergy's 350MW/700MWh Joel Joel project. ACEnergy has announced that its 350MW Joel Joel BESS project has become the first project approved under the Victorian Government's accelerated and streamlined renewable energy planning process.
